Regional business development initiatives launched in San Antonio and San Fernando
Regional economic development initiatives are underway in San Antonio and San Fernando. In San Antonio, FOSIS has begun distributing funds through its Semilla Program to support more than 120 entrepreneurs. The initiative aims to provide resources and tools to strengthen local businesses, with local authorities noting that over 300 entrepreneurs in the area are currently working in coordination with FOSIS. More than 90% of the participants in this program are women.
In San Fernando, a Business Round was held involving more than 250 companies to strengthen the local productive network and create new commercial links for SMEs and small producers. Organized by the San Fernando Production Secretariat in coordination with the Government of the Province of Buenos Aires, the event focused on improving sector competitiveness. Provincial officials highlighted the availability of support tools, including credit lines, training, and programs related to export and the knowledge economy.
